Hogwarts Legacy had the most successful video game launch of 2023 and for good reason. The Wizarding World has been waiting decades for a game of this quality. The result is an open-world RPG that stands on its own feet — you do not need to be a Harry Potter fan to love it.
The World
Hogwarts Castle is the centrepiece and it is spectacular. Every corner has detail. The surrounding regions — Hogsmeade, the Forbidden Forest, rolling highlands — expand the map without padding it. Side quests feel purposeful rather than filler.
Magic Combat System
Spell-slinging combat starts accessible and gets deep. Combining spells, using environmental objects as weapons, and adapting to different enemy types keeps fights interesting across the 40+ hour campaign.
Performance Note for Kenya
On PS5 and Xbox Series X, the game runs beautifully at 60fps in performance mode. Loading times are near-instant thanks to SSD architecture. The experience justifies the hardware investment.
